Job Description

Identity Application Architect

Thinkahead Consultant Psychologist Pty Ltd

• Lead the architecture and design of CIAM and IAM solutions supporting secure customer, partner, and workforce identity use cases across digital and enterprise environments, including authentication, authorization, federation, lifecycle automation, and secure access patterns. • Define reference architectures, technical standards, guardrails, and integration patterns for identity services and applications using protocols and technologies such as OAuth 2.0, OpenID Connect, SAML, SCIM, LDAP, REST APIs, webhooks, and event-driven architectures. • Architect and guide implementation of identity-enabled applications, APIs, portals, and workflows, including customer onboarding, workforce onboarding, joiner-mover-leaver processes, access requests, delegated administration, MFA, identity proofing, registration, account recovery, consent, and progressive profiling. • Drive architecture decisions for identity data models, directory strategy, attribute governance, role, group, and policy design, and integrations across HR, CRM, ITSM, cloud, and other enterprise platforms. • Evaluate and improve identity platforms, integrations, and access patterns to reduce risk, technical debt, and operational friction while ensuring resilience, scalability, observability, auditability, privacy, and compliance by design. • Produce architecture diagrams, standards, roadmaps, decision records, and implementation guidance, and lead design reviews, governance activities, and stakeholder communication to align delivery with security requirements and strategic objectives. • Mentor engineers and administrators, collaborate with vendors and internal teams, and stay current on IAM and CIAM trends, threats, standards, and capabilities to drive continuous improvement and informed architectural recommendations.

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Cybersecurity, Software Engineering, or a related field, or equivalent practical experience.
  • 8+ years of progressive experience in identity and access management, application security, or enterprise architecture, including significant experience designing identity solutions in complex environments.
  • 5+ years of experience architecting or leading implementations for CIAM and/or IAM platforms, including authentication, federation, authorization, and lifecycle orchestration use cases.
  • Practical experience designing integrations across identity providers, cloud platforms, customer-facing applications, HR systems, CRM platforms, IT service management systems, and related enterprise applications.
  • Expertise in platforms and services such as Okta, Auth0, Microsoft Entra ID, AWS, Azure, Salesforce, ServiceNow, or comparable identity and business platforms.
  • Demonstrated success in leading technical design for secure APIs, identity-aware applications, and event-driven or service-based integrations.
  • Required certification in at least one relevant identity or cybersecurity discipline, such as CISSP, CCSP, IDPro, Okta Certified Administrator or Developer, Microsoft SC-300, AWS Security Specialty, or comparable credentials.
